Assam–Meghalaya Vehicle Blockade Continues for Second Day

Guwahati: Vehicular movement between Assam and Meghalaya remained disrupted for the second consecutive day on Friday as protesters at Jorabat continued to block vehicles bearing Meghalaya registration numbers. The agitation follows reported violence during a KSU rally in Shillong, with protesters demanding accountability and stronger security for Assam residents and commercial drivers travelling through Meghalaya.
The protesters warned that the blockade could intensify if their concerns remain unaddressed, while several drivers reported difficulties travelling along the Guwahati–Shillong route. Protesters also claimed they had not received any formal communication from either government regarding their demands.
